日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

探索手機(jī)應(yīng)用開發(fā)之路:編程軟件與開發(fā)流程詳解

開發(fā)手機(jī)App使用哪些編程軟件?

隨著移動(dòng)技術(shù)的飛速發(fā)展,開發(fā)手機(jī)應(yīng)用程序已成為熱門行業(yè)。對(duì)于開發(fā)者而言,選擇合適的編程工具是成功的關(guān)鍵。目前,兩大主流移動(dòng)操作系統(tǒng)——Android和iOS,分別擁有其專屬的編程軟件。

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

對(duì)于Android應(yīng)用開發(fā),Google提供的Android Studio是首選環(huán)境。這款軟件不僅集成了開發(fā)Android應(yīng)用所需的所有工具,還支持Java和Kotlin兩種編程語(yǔ)言。Android Studio擁有強(qiáng)大的代碼編輯器和調(diào)試工具,幫助開發(fā)者高效完成代碼編寫和測(cè)試。其豐富的Android SDK和模擬器讓開發(fā)者能在不同版本的Android系統(tǒng)上進(jìn)行測(cè)試。

而對(duì)于iOS應(yīng)用開發(fā),Xcode是蘋果公司的官方開發(fā)工具套件。它支持Swift和Objective-C編程語(yǔ)言,提供了全面的代碼編輯器、調(diào)試工具以及各種庫(kù)和框架。尤其值得一提的是,Xcode的Interface Builder和Storyboard功能在界面設(shè)計(jì)和交互體驗(yàn)方面表現(xiàn)出色,助力開發(fā)者構(gòu)建美觀且易用的iOS應(yīng)用。

除了這些原生開發(fā)工具,還有一些跨平臺(tái)開發(fā)工具如React Native、Flutter等也備受關(guān)注。這些工具允許開發(fā)者使用同一套代碼同時(shí)開發(fā)Android和iOS應(yīng)用,提高了開發(fā)效率和代碼復(fù)用性。

如何自己開發(fā)App軟件?

想要踏入App開發(fā)領(lǐng)域,了解開發(fā)流程及費(fèi)用是關(guān)鍵。App開發(fā)主要分為固定款和定制款兩種款式,價(jià)格及開發(fā)方式各不相同。

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

固定款A(yù)pp是指直接套用已有的模板,報(bào)價(jià)固定,功能也固定。這種方式的開發(fā)時(shí)間短,約2~3天即可完成,費(fèi)用相對(duì)較低,大約在幾千到幾萬(wàn)之間。但需要注意的是,由于源代碼是封裝的,客戶無(wú)法拿到,也不能根據(jù)企業(yè)需求進(jìn)行定制。如果未來(lái)想進(jìn)行功能升級(jí)或系統(tǒng)維護(hù),只能重新開發(fā)新的軟件。

定制款A(yù)pp則是指根據(jù)企業(yè)的需求和設(shè)計(jì)定制開發(fā)的功能。這種方式需要美工、策劃、APP開發(fā)等多個(gè)工種協(xié)同完成,開發(fā)周期較長(zhǎng),費(fèi)用也相對(duì)較高,大概在幾萬(wàn)甚至十幾萬(wàn)不等。由于APP的功能和設(shè)計(jì)都是定制的,因此能夠滿足企業(yè)的個(gè)性化需求。

想要了解開發(fā)一款手機(jī)App需要花費(fèi)多少錢,企業(yè)主必須明確App的詳細(xì)需求和功能,以便開發(fā)公司能報(bào)出一個(gè)合理的價(jià)格。隨著移動(dòng)應(yīng)用的普及和發(fā)展,App開發(fā)已成為一個(gè)充滿機(jī)遇和挑戰(zhàn)的領(lǐng)域。對(duì)于想要踏入這一領(lǐng)域的人來(lái)說(shuō),了解編程軟件及開發(fā)流程是邁向成功的第一步。

隨著技術(shù)的不斷進(jìn)步,App開發(fā)工具和平臺(tái)也在不斷更新和完善,為開發(fā)者提供了更多的選擇和可能性。無(wú)論是選擇原生開發(fā)工具還是跨平臺(tái)工具,開發(fā)者都可以根據(jù)自身的需求和經(jīng)驗(yàn),選擇最適合自己的編程軟件。明確開發(fā)流程和費(fèi)用也是確保項(xiàng)目順利進(jìn)行的關(guān)鍵。移動(dòng)應(yīng)用開發(fā)與成本分析

一、引言

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

隨著智能手機(jī)的普及,移動(dòng)應(yīng)用開發(fā)成為了一個(gè)熱門話題。不同的手機(jī)APP平臺(tái)制作成本各異,本文將深入探討手機(jī)APP的制作成本及相關(guān)因素。

二、手機(jī)APP平臺(tái)與制作成本

當(dāng)前市場(chǎng)上流行的手機(jī)APP制作平臺(tái)主要分為安卓系統(tǒng)(Android)和蘋果系統(tǒng)(IOS)。由于蘋果公司對(duì)平臺(tái)的封閉性和手機(jī)APP開發(fā)語(yǔ)言的特殊性,制作蘋果系統(tǒng)的手機(jī)APP軟件費(fèi)用相對(duì)安卓平臺(tái)會(huì)稍高一些。

三、APP制作成本的人員投入

開發(fā)一款A(yù)PP通常需要多方人員的協(xié)作,包括產(chǎn)品經(jīng)理、客戶端工程師、后端工程師和UI設(shè)計(jì)師等。這些人員的工資是APP制作成本的重要組成部分。這些工作人員的月薪總和可能會(huì)超過(guò)4、5萬(wàn)元。在評(píng)估APP制作成本時(shí),人員工資是一個(gè)不可忽視的因素。

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

四、APP開發(fā)公司的地理位置

值得注意的是,同樣實(shí)力的APP開發(fā)公司,在不同的城市也會(huì)導(dǎo)致APP的成本費(fèi)用有所差異。一線城市的開發(fā)成本會(huì)相對(duì)較高,而二線、三線城市的開發(fā)成本則會(huì)相對(duì)較低。

五、APP開發(fā)常用的編程軟件及其特點(diǎn)

1. Android Studio:作為Android應(yīng)用開發(fā)的官方集成開發(fā)環(huán)境,它提供了豐富的工具集,支持Java和Kotlin兩種編程語(yǔ)言,特別適用于為Android設(shè)備構(gòu)建應(yīng)用。

2. Xcode:Apple提供的開發(fā)工具套件,用于開發(fā)macOS和iOS應(yīng)用程序,是開發(fā)iPhone、iPad等蘋果設(shè)備應(yīng)用的必備工具。Xcode支持Swift和Objective-C兩種編程語(yǔ)言。

編程實(shí)戰(zhàn):開發(fā)定制化App的解決之道與攻略

3. Visual Studio:支持多種編程語(yǔ)言,并通過(guò)Visual Studio App Center進(jìn)行應(yīng)用的構(gòu)建、測(cè)試和分發(fā)。與Xamarin結(jié)合使用時(shí),可以實(shí)現(xiàn)跨平臺(tái)應(yīng)用開發(fā)的高效性。近年來(lái)跨平臺(tái)移動(dòng)應(yīng)用開發(fā)框架如React Native和Flutter逐漸受到關(guān)注。React Native允許使用JavaScript和React構(gòu)建原生渲染的移動(dòng)應(yīng)用,而Flutter則是Google推出的開源移動(dòng)UI工具包,使用Dart語(yǔ)言進(jìn)行編程。這兩個(gè)框架都提供了豐富的組件和高效的性能,使得跨平臺(tái)應(yīng)用開發(fā)更加簡(jiǎn)單和快捷。在選擇編程軟件時(shí),開發(fā)者需要根據(jù)具體需求和目標(biāo)平臺(tái)來(lái)決定。無(wú)論是專注于單一平臺(tái)還是追求跨平臺(tái)兼容性都有相應(yīng)的編程軟件可以滿足需求。此外隨著技術(shù)的不斷進(jìn)步新的開發(fā)工具和框架不斷涌現(xiàn)也在不斷地推動(dòng)著移動(dòng)應(yīng)用開發(fā)行業(yè)的進(jìn)步和發(fā)展??傊苿?dòng)應(yīng)用開發(fā)是一個(gè)充滿機(jī)遇和挑戰(zhàn)的領(lǐng)域其制作成本受到多種因素的影響包括平臺(tái)、人員投入和地理位置等。在選擇開發(fā)工具和框架時(shí)開發(fā)者需要根據(jù)自身需求和項(xiàng)目特點(diǎn)做出明智的決策以實(shí)現(xiàn)高效、高質(zhì)量的移動(dòng)應(yīng)用開發(fā)。


本文原地址:http://m.czyjwy.com/news/52607.html
本站文章均來(lái)自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請(qǐng)郵箱聯(lián)系我們刪除!
上一篇:編程實(shí)戰(zhàn):輕松打造軟件應(yīng)用APP開發(fā)教程
下一篇:編程實(shí)現(xiàn)APP開發(fā):從入門到精通的解決方案指南